Programme Summary
The Undergraduate Certificate in Mathematical Connections in Physics and Math is designed for students with a foundational understanding of mathematics and physics who are eager to deepen their knowledge and explore the intricate interplay between these two disciplines. This program focuses on advanced mathematical concepts and their applications in physics, including but not limited to calculus, linear algebra, differential equations, and vector calculus, all of which are crucial for understanding physical phenomena. It also covers modern topics such as computational methods, quantum mechanics, and statistical physics.
Students in this program will develop a robust set of analytical and problem-solving skills, enabling them to model and solve complex real-world problems. They will gain proficiency in using mathematical tools and techniques to analyze physical systems, and will learn to apply these skills in both theoretical and applied contexts. The curriculum emphasizes both the theoretical foundations and practical applications, fostering a deep understanding of the mathematical underpinnings of physical theories and their experimental verification.

Course Modules
- Calculus Fundamentals: Covers the core principles of differential and integral calculus.: Linear Algebra Basics: Introduces vector spaces, matrices, and linear transformations.
- Probability and Statistics: Explores basic probability theory and statistical methods.: Differential Equations: Analyzes ordinary and partial differential equations and their applications.
- Mathematical Physics: Studies mathematical methods used in physics problems.: Computational Methods: Focuses on numerical techniques and software tools for mathematical and physical problems.
